Libro Adivinanzas, Risas y Chanzas

The rhymes, verses, songs, and riddles in this playful book are designed for children who cannot get enough of word games. Beautiful illustrations bring humor and laughs to every page. Los niños que disfrutan de los juegos de palabras gozarán de las rimas, los versos, las canciones y las adivinanzas en este libro juguetón. Bellas ilustraciones traen humor y carcajadas a cada página.

Libro ¿Dónde Viven los Animales?

Young readers are introduced to the concept of habitats in this colorful book. Each spread describes a different habitat and the animals that live there. Children will learn about habitats in forests, deserts, grasslands, wetlands, on mountains, and in the Arctic and Antarctic. An activity asks readers to use what they have learned to match photos of habitats with their habitat names.

Libro La Gente y la Cultura (the People and Culture of Latin America)

"Latin America's population is estimated to be well over half a billion people, almost one-tenth of the world's population, living in thirty-three different countries and territories. This engrossing book explores the people of South America, Central America, Mexico, and the West Indies and provides extensive detail on their diverse cultures. An authoritative overview of the varied and rich traditions of each of these regions is presented, as well as a thorough discussion of the religions, languages, and ethnicities of Latin Americans."
